Trapped in a Loaf Meatloaf
From midgelet 15 years agoIngredients
- 1 round loaf of fFrench or Sourdough shopping list
- 1 small onion chopped shopping list
- 1 cup mushroom sliced or use a can well drained shopping list
- 2 Tbs catsup shopping list
- 1 large egg shopping list
- 1 cup cheddar cheese, shredded shopping list
- 1/2 cup red wine shopping list
- 1 tsp garlic salt shopping list
- 1/4 tsp thyme leaves shopping list
- 1 lb ground sirloin , top round or good quality beef ( you don't want very fatty beef becasue bread would soak up excess fat) shopping list
How to make it
- Cut a thin slice from top of loaf, scoop out soft insides of bread.
- Use enough bread to make 1 1/2 cups fresh crumbs.
- Save remainders for other uses
- Brown onion in a bit of oil or butter.
- Add and saute mushrooms or use canned drained ones instead.
- Mix egg and catsup.
- Stir in bread crumbs, onions, 1/2 cup of cheese, wine and seasonings.
- Mix into beef well.
- Spoon meat mixture into hollowed out bread.
- Rub entire crust with some soft butter.
- Wrap entire loaf in foil.
- Bake 375 about 1 1/2 hours.
- Fold back top foil and srpinkle meat with remaining 1/2 cup of cheese.
- Return loaf and bake a few minutes until cheese melts.
- Cool about 10 minutes or so
- To serve, cut into slices
